The price of Antam gold, monitored on the Logam Mulia website in Jakarta on Monday (30/3/2026), has fallen by Rp30,000 from the previous Rp2,837,000 to Rp2,807,000 per gram. The buyback price has also decreased to Rp2,425,000 per gram.

Antam gold prices can change at any time. Sales transactions are subject to tax deductions in accordance with PMK No. 34/PMK.10/2017 for all types of gold from 1 gram to 1,000 grams (1 kilogram).

The resale of gold bars to PT Antam Tbk for amounts exceeding Rp10 million is subject to Income Tax (PPh) Article 22 at 1.5% for holders of a Taxpayer Identification Number (NPWP) and 3% for non-NPWP holders.

PPh Article 22 on buyback transactions is deducted directly from the total buyback value.

Tax deductions on gold purchase prices are in accordance with PMK No. 34/PMK.10/2017. Purchases of gold bars are subject to PPh Article 22 at 0.45% for NPWP holders and 0.9% for non-NPWP holders. Every gold bar purchase is accompanied by a PPh Article 22 withholding receipt.
